A leading sofa retail specialist in the UK is looking for a Production Operative to join their dynamic manufacturing team in Doncaster. This full-time position requires no prior experience—just a desire to succeed and learn.

Responsibilities include:

  • Ensuring materials and products are available throughout the factory
  • Developing specialized skills over time

Employees benefit from a variety of perks including overtime pay, holiday allowances, and discounts on various services and products.

How to prepare for a job interview at DFS Furniture PLC

✨Show Your Enthusiasm to Learn

Since this role doesn’t require prior experience, it’s crucial to express your eagerness to learn upholstery and sewing. Share any relevant experiences where you’ve picked up new skills quickly or tackled challenges head-on. This will show the employer that you’re ready to dive in and grow with the team.

✨Research the Company

Take some time to understand the sofa retail specialist's values, products, and what sets them apart in the market. Mentioning specific details during your interview can demonstrate your genuine interest in the company and how you see yourself fitting into their dynamic manufacturing team.

✨Prepare Questions to Ask

Think of a few thoughtful questions to ask at the end of your interview. This could be about the training process for new operatives or what a typical day looks like in the factory. Asking questions shows that you’re engaged and serious about the position, plus it gives you valuable insights into the role.

✨Dress for Success

Even though the job is in a manufacturing environment, it’s still important to present yourself well. Opt for smart-casual attire that reflects professionalism while being comfortable. This will help you make a positive first impression and show that you take the opportunity seriously.
